Author: sisbell Date: Mon Mar 19 20:16:41 2007 New Revision: 520248 URL: http://svn.apache.org/viewvc?view=rev&rev=520248 Log: Updated NUnit assembly to be compatible with MS, Mono and DotGnu. Simplified the build further.
Added: incubator/nmaven/branches/SI_IDE/thirdparty/NUnit/ incubator/nmaven/branches/SI_IDE/thirdparty/NUnit/NUnit.Framework.dll (with props) Removed: incubator/nmaven/branches/SI_IDE/plugins/scripts/ incubator/nmaven/branches/SI_IDE/thirdparty/NUnit-1.1/ incubator/nmaven/branches/SI_IDE/thirdparty/NUnit-2.0/ Modified: incubator/nmaven/branches/SI_IDE/README.txt inc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Core/pom.xml inc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Model/Pom/pom.xml inc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Plugin.Resx/pom.xml inc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Plugin.Settings/pom.xml inc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Plugin.Solution/pom.xml incubator/nmaven/branches/SI_IDE/assemblies/pom.xml incubator/nmaven/branches/SI_IDE/bootstrap-build.bat inc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0001/pom.xml inc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0002/pom.xml inc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0004/pom.xml inc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0017/pom.xml incubator/nmaven/branches/SI_IDE/site/src/site/apt/getting-started.apt Modified: incubator/nmaven/branches/SI_IDE/README.txt URL: http://svn.apache.org/viewvc/incubator/nmaven/branches/SI_IDE/README.txt?view=diff&rev=520248&r1=520247&r2=520248 ============================================================================== --- incubator/nmaven/branches/SI_IDE/README.txt (original) +++ incubator/nmaven/branches/SI_IDE/README.txt Mon Mar 19 20:16:41 2007 @@ -1,5 +1,12 @@ Initial Build -* On the first build, execute the bootstrap-build script. On subsequent builds, you can just type mvn install from +* On the first build, for Windows execute + bootstrap-build.bat or + bootstrap-build.bat -DwithIDE" + Or on *nix, + bootstrap-build.sh + +Note that the -DwithIDE option requires Microsoft 2.0 or higher. If this is a clean build (meaning that you do not have a ~./m2/nmaven-settings.xml file) +then you will also need to make sure that you have csc within your path. On subsequent builds, you can just type mvn install from the command prompt. IntelliJ IDEA Setup Modified: inc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Core/pom.xml URL: http://svn.apache.org/viewvc/inc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Core/pom.xml?view=diff&rev=520248&r1=520247&r2=520248 ============================================================================== --- inc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Core/pom.xml (original) +++ inc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Core/pom.xml Mon Mar 19 20:16:41 2007 @@ -1,8 +1,8 @@ <project xmlns="http://maven.apache.org/POM/4.0.0"> <parent> - <groupId>org.apache.maven.dotnet</groupId> + <groupId>NMaven</groupId> <version>0.14</version> - <artifactId>nmaven-assemblies</artifactId> + <artifactId>NMaven.Assemblies</artifactId> </parent> <modelVersion>4.0.0</modelVersion> <groupId>NMaven.Core</groupId> @@ -25,7 +25,7 @@ </dependency> <dependency> <groupId>NUnit</groupId> - <artifactId>Nunit.Framework</artifactId> + <artifactId>NUnit.Framework</artifactId> <version>2.2.8.0</version> <type>library</type> </dependency> Modified: inc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Model/Pom/pom.xml URL: http://svn.apache.org/viewvc/inc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Model/Pom/pom.xml?view=diff&rev=520248&r1=520247&r2=520248 ============================================================================== --- inc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Model/Pom/pom.xml (original) +++ inc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Model/Pom/pom.xml Mon Mar 19 20:16:41 2007 @@ -1,10 +1,10 @@ <project xmlns="http://maven.apache.org/POM/4.0.0"> <parent> - <groupId>org.apache.maven.dotnet</groupId> + <groupId>NMaven</groupId> <version>0.14</version> - <artifactId>nmaven-assemblies</artifactId> + <artifactId>NMaven.Assemblies</artifactId> <relativePath>..\..\pom.xml</relativePath> - </parent> + </parent> <modelVersion>4.0.0</modelVersion> <groupId>NMaven.Model</groupId> <artifactId>NMaven.Model.Pom</artifactId> Modified: inc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Plugin.Resx/pom.xml URL: http://svn.apache.org/viewvc/inc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Plugin.Resx/pom.xml?view=diff&rev=520248&r1=520247&r2=520248 ============================================================================== --- inc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Plugin.Resx/pom.xml (original) +++ inc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Plugin.Resx/pom.xml Mon Mar 19 20:16:41 2007 @@ -1,8 +1,8 @@ <project xmlns="http://maven.apache.org/POM/4.0.0"> <parent> - <groupId>org.apache.maven.dotnet</groupId> + <groupId>NMaven.A</groupId> <version>0.14</version> - <artifactId>nmaven-assemblies</artifactId> + <artifactId>NMaven.Assemblies</artifactId> </parent> <modelVersion>4.0.0</modelVersion> <groupId>NMaven.Plugin</groupId> Modified: inc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Plugin.Settings/pom.xml URL: http://svn.apache.org/viewvc/inc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Plugin.Settings/pom.xml?view=diff&rev=520248&r1=520247&r2=520248 ============================================================================== --- inc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Plugin.Settings/pom.xml (original) +++ inc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Plugin.Settings/pom.xml Mon Mar 19 20:16:41 2007 @@ -1,8 +1,8 @@ <project xmlns="http://maven.apache.org/POM/4.0.0"> <parent> - <groupId>org.apache.maven.dotnet</groupId> + <groupId>NMaven.A</groupId> <version>0.14</version> - <artifactId>nmaven-assemblies</artifactId> + <artifactId>NMaven.Assemblies</artifactId> </parent> <modelVersion>4.0.0</modelVersion> <groupId>NMaven.Plugin</groupId> Modified: inc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Plugin.Solution/pom.xml URL: http://svn.apache.org/viewvc/inc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Plugin.Solution/pom.xml?view=diff&rev=520248&r1=520247&r2=520248 ============================================================================== --- inc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Plugin.Solution/pom.xml (original) +++ incubator/nmaven/branches/SI_IDE/assemblies/NMaven.Plugin.Solution/pom.xml Mon Mar 19 20:16:41 2007 @@ -1,8 +1,8 @@ <project xmlns="http://maven.apache.org/POM/4.0.0"> <parent> - <groupId>org.apache.maven.dotnet</groupId> + <groupId>NMaven</groupId> <version>0.14</version> - <artifactId>nmaven-assemblies</artifactId> + <artifactId>NMaven.Assemblies</artifactId> </parent> <modelVersion>4.0.0</modelVersion> <groupId>NMaven.Plugin</groupId> @@ -13,7 +13,7 @@ <dependencies> <dependency> <groupId>NUnit</groupId> - <artifactId>Nunit.Framework</artifactId> + <artifactId>NUnit.Framework</artifactId> <version>2.2.8.0</version> <type>library</type> </dependency> Modified: incubator/nmaven/branches/SI_IDE/assemblies/pom.xml URL: http://svn.apache.org/viewvc/incubator/nmaven/branches/SI_IDE/assemblies/pom.xml?view=diff&rev=520248&r1=520247&r2=520248 ============================================================================== --- incubator/nmaven/branches/SI_IDE/assemblies/pom.xml (original) +++ incubator/nmaven/branches/SI_IDE/assemblies/pom.xml Mon Mar 19 20:16:41 2007 @@ -1,11 +1,11 @@ <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/maven-v4_0_0.xsd"> <modelVersion>4.0.0</modelVersion> - <groupId>org.apache.maven.dotnet</groupId> - <artifactId>nmaven-assemblies</artifactId> + <groupId>NMaven.A</groupId> + <artifactId>NMaven.Assemblies</artifactId> <packaging>pom</packaging> <version>0.14</version> - <name>nmaven-assemblies</name> + <name>NMaven.Assemblies</name> <url>http://incubator.apache.org/nmaven</url> <description> NMaven provides Maven 2.x plugins to support building of .NET applications Modified: incubator/nmaven/branches/SI_IDE/bootstrap-build.bat URL: http://svn.apache.org/viewvc/incubator/nmaven/branches/SI_IDE/bootstrap-build.bat?view=diff&rev=520248&r1=520247&r2=520248 ============================================================================== --- incubator/nmaven/branches/SI_IDE/bootstrap-build.bat (original) +++ incubator/nmaven/branches/SI_IDE/bootstrap-build.bat Mon Mar 19 20:16:41 2007 @@ -1,5 +1,5 @@ call mvn -f ./components/pom.xml install call mvn -f ./plugins/pom.xml install -call mvn org.apache.maven.dotnet.plugins:maven-install-plugin:install-file -Dfile=./thirdparty/NUnit-2.0/nunit.framework.dll -DgroupId=NUnit -DartifactId=NUnit.Framework -Dpackaging=dll -Dversion=2.2.8.0 +call mvn org.apache.maven.dotnet.plugins:maven-install-plugin:install-file -Dfile=./thirdparty/NUnit/NUnit.Framework.dll -DgroupId=NUnit -DartifactId=NUnit.Framework -Dpackaging=dll -Dversion=2.2.8.0 call mvn -f ./assemblies/pom.xml -Dmaven.test.skip=true -Dbootstrap install %* rem call mvn org.apache.maven.dotnet.plugins:maven-solution-plugin:solution Modified: inc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0001/pom.xml URL: http://svn.apache.org/viewvc/inc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0001/pom.xml?view=diff&rev=520248&r1=520247&r2=520248 ============================================================================== --- inc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0001/pom.xml (original) +++ inc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0001/pom.xml Mon Mar 19 20:16:41 2007 @@ -1,19 +1,18 @@ <project> - <modelVersion>4.0.0</modelVersion> - <groupId>org.apache.maven.it</groupId> - <artifactId>it0001</artifactId> - <packaging>module</packaging> - <version>1.0.0</version> - <name>it0001</name> - - <build> - <sourceDirectory>src/main/csharp</sourceDirectory> - <plugins> - <plugin> - <groupId>org.apache.maven.dotnet.plugins</groupId> - <artifactId>maven-compile-plugin</artifactId> - <extensions>true</extensions> - </plugin> - </plugins> - </build> + <modelVersion>4.0.0</modelVersion> + <groupId>org.apache.maven.it</groupId> + <artifactId>it0001</artifactId> + <packaging>module</packaging> + <version>1.0.0</version> + <name>it0001</name> + <build> + <sourceDirectory>src/main/csharp</sourceDirectory> + <plugins> + <plugin> + <groupId>org.apache.maven.dotnet.plugins</groupId> + <artifactId>maven-compile-plugin</artifactId> + <extensions>true</extensions> + </plugin> + </plugins> + </build> </project> Modified: inc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0002/pom.xml URL: http://svn.apache.org/viewvc/inc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0002/pom.xml?view=diff&rev=520248&r1=520247&r2=520248 ============================================================================== --- inc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0002/pom.xml (original) +++ inc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0002/pom.xml Mon Mar 19 20:16:41 2007 @@ -1,27 +1,26 @@ <project> - <modelVersion>4.0.0</modelVersion> - <groupId>org.apache.maven.it</groupId> - <artifactId>it0002</artifactId> - <packaging>library</packaging> - <version>1.0.0</version> - <name>it0002</name> - - <dependencies> - <dependency> - <groupId>org.apache.maven.it</groupId> - <artifactId>it0001</artifactId> - <type>module</type> - <version>1.0.0</version> - </dependency> - </dependencies> - <build> - <sourceDirectory>src/main/csharp</sourceDirectory> - <plugins> - <plugin> - <groupId>org.apache.maven.dotnet.plugins</groupId> - <artifactId>maven-compile-plugin</artifactId> - <extensions>true</extensions> - </plugin> - </plugins> - </build> + <modelVersion>4.0.0</modelVersion> + <groupId>org.apache.maven.it</groupId> + <artifactId>it0002</artifactId> + <packaging>library</packaging> + <version>1.0.0</version> + <name>it0002</name> + <dependencies> + <dependency> + <groupId>org.apache.maven.it</groupId> + <artifactId>it0001</artifactId> + <type>module</type> + <version>1.0.0</version> + </dependency> + </dependencies> + <build> + <sourceDirectory>src/main/csharp</sourceDirectory> + <plugins> + <plugin> + <groupId>org.apache.maven.dotnet.plugins</groupId> + <artifactId>maven-compile-plugin</artifactId> + <extensions>true</extensions> + </plugin> + </plugins> + </build> </project> Modified: inc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0004/pom.xml URL: http://svn.apache.org/viewvc/inc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0004/pom.xml?view=diff&rev=520248&r1=520247&r2=520248 ============================================================================== --- inc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0004/pom.xml (original) +++ inc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0004/pom.xml Mon Mar 19 20:16:41 2007 @@ -14,7 +14,7 @@ </dependency> <dependency> <groupId>NUnit</groupId> - <artifactId>Nunit.Framework</artifactId> + <artifactId>NUnit.Framework</artifactId> <version>2.2.8.0</version> <type>library</type> </dependency> Modified: inc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0017/pom.xml URL: http://svn.apache.org/viewvc/inc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0017/pom.xml?view=diff&rev=520248&r1=520247&r2=520248 ============================================================================== --- inc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0017/pom.xml (original) +++ incubator/nmaven/branches/SI_IDE/integration-tests/tests/it0017/pom.xml Mon Mar 19 20:16:41 2007 @@ -14,7 +14,7 @@ </dependency> <dependency> <groupId>NUnit</groupId> - <artifactId>Nunit.Framework</artifactId> + <artifactId>NUnit.Framework</artifactId> <version>2.2.8.0</version> <type>library</type> </dependency> Modified: incubator/nmaven/branches/SI_IDE/site/src/site/apt/getting-started.apt URL: http://svn.apache.org/viewvc/incubator/nmaven/branches/SI_IDE/site/src/site/apt/getting-started.apt?view=diff&rev=520248&r1=520247&r2=520248 ============================================================================== --- incubator/nmaven/branches/SI_IDE/site/src/site/apt/getting-started.apt (original) +++ incubator/nmaven/branches/SI_IDE/site/src/site/apt/getting-started.apt Mon Mar 19 20:16:41 2007 @@ -110,7 +110,7 @@ <dependency> <groupId>NUnit</groupId> - <artifactId>Nunit.Framework</artifactId> + <artifactId>nunit.framework</artifactId> <version>2.2.8.0</version> <type>library</type> </dependency> Added: incubator/nmaven/branches/SI_IDE/thirdparty/NUnit/NUnit.Framework.dll URL: http://svn.apache.org/viewvc/incubator/nmaven/branches/SI_IDE/thirdparty/NUnit/NUnit.Framework.dll?view=auto&rev=520248 ============================================================================== Binary file - no diff available. Propchange: incubator/nmaven/branches/SI_IDE/thirdparty/NUnit/NUnit.Framework.dll ------------------------------------------------------------------------------ svn:mime-type = application/octet-stream